The flrst shipment of new sugars ex Emma from Mauritius was offered at the rooms of Messrs ITliiindress, Hepburn, and Co., to-day. There was a full attendance of the trade. On account of telegrams received from Melbourne in the course of the to enoou stating that an advance L 5 per ton he. 1 taken place in London, and L 3 per ton in the Melbourne market, aom>. little excitement was manifested. The result of the sales etfected mus a decided advance of from 80s to 40s per ton, and at those rates the auctioneer only allowed small parcels of each_ line to pass the hammer and reserved the remainder for further advices. Finest whites realised L3B 2s Gd; second <V\ L' 36; finest yellow, L3B ss; second do, L32to L 32 os. BAILWAY BETUEK3.
